Description

If any documents required for a petition or application do not exist or cannot be obtained, the petitioner or applicant must demonstrate the unavailability of the required documents, as well as of relevant secondary evidence, and submit two or more affidavits. The affidavits must be sworn to or affirmed by persons who are not parties to the petition who have direct personal knowledge of the event and circumstances. The applicant or petitioner who has not been able to acquire the necessary document or statement from the relevant foreign authority may submit evidence that repeated good faith attempts were made to obtain the required document or statement.

Types of Wisconsin Affidavit and Proof of Naturalized Citizenship: While specific names for the Wisconsin Affidavit and Proof of Naturalized Citizenship documents may vary, their purpose remains the same. Some common types include: a) Wisconsin Affidavit of Naturalization: This affidavit is a sworn statement signed by the naturalized citizen, affirming the details of their naturalization process. It includes their full legal name, date of naturalization, and other pertinent information as required by Wisconsin state law. b) Naturalization Certificate: This official document is issued by the USCIS to individuals who have successfully completed the naturalization process. The Naturalization Certificate serves as irrefutable proof of an individual's U.S. citizenship. It includes essential information such as the applicant's name, date of birth, date of naturalization, and alien registration number. c) Passport: A U.S. passport can also serve as evidence of naturalized citizenship. When applying for a passport, individuals must present their Naturalization Certificate or other official documentation to support their eligibility for a U.S. passport. The passport confirms both the holder's identity and U.S. citizenship. d) Certificate of Citizenship: In some cases, individuals may obtain U.S. citizenship through means other than naturalization. The Certificate of Citizenship is issued by the USCIS to individuals who acquired citizenship through their parents or other specified circumstances. This document serves as proof of citizenship in these particular cases. 4. You can obtain proof of naturalization by requesting a replacement Naturalization Certificate from U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S). If you have lost your certificate, you can file Form N-565 to replace it.
